The Ethereum-linked NFT market is currently facing short-term challenges as it navigates a consolidation phase. Recent trends indicate a decline in prices for large NFT collections, suggesting a cautious sentiment among investors. The source notes that this trend may continue if market conditions do not improve soon.
Market Overview
Prices for major NFT collections have seen a downturn, but this appears to be more a reflection of market reservation than panic selling. As Ethereum's price fluctuates within established technical boundaries, the NFT market is undergoing a necessary recalibration.
Price Stability in High-Value Collections
Despite the overall price drop, high-value collections are exhibiting a degree of price stability, attributed to limited turnover. This situation indicates that the market is still engaged in price discovery as collectors and investors reassess the value of their digital assets in the current economic climate.
